So I have been informed that the Schützenschnur cannot be put on an ERB but you can wear it. I have also been informed that the award can be put on an ERB but cannot be worn anymore. I have the badge and have worn it since I received the certificate but am now unsure of what is actually authorized. I have checked the regulations but cannot find any hard information. Anyone know and can reference?

AR 670–1 • 10 April 2015
22–18. Foreign badges
a. Personnel may only wear one foreign badge at a time on the Army service and dress uniforms. Only those badges awarded in recognition of military activities by the military department of the host country are authorized for acceptance and permanent wear on the service and dress uniforms.
b. The only Vietnamese badges authorized for wear are the parachute, ranger, and explosive ordnance disposal badges.
c. Soldiers must obtain approval in accordance with the procedures provided in AR 600-8-22, to accept, retain, and wear a foreign badge.
d. See DA Pam 670–1 for wear of foreign badges.

DA PAM 670–1 • 1 July 2015- 22-18 b. The German Marksmanship Award (Schuetzenschnur) is authorized for wear only by enlisted personnel. Officers may accept, but may not wear, the Schuetzenschnur. If authorized, personnel wear the award on the right side of the uniform coat, with the upper portion attached under the center of the shoulder loop, and the bottom portion attached under the lapel to a button mounted specifically for wearing this award.
